Fuji decided to discontinue:

Fuji 100B in 3x4 and 4x5 sizes.
Fuji 400B in 3x4 and 4x5 sizes.
Fuji 500B in 4x5.



//////////////////////

Still available are:

Fuji 100C
Fuji 3000B

The 545 doesn't work with pack films, only with single sheets.

Edit: The Polaroid 550 works, but they are harder to find it seems.
